#header { background-color: #14090d; background-image: url(images/sdesign/racing.jpg); background-repeat: no-repeat; background-position: center top; position: relative; width:519px; height: 139px; margin-right: auto; margin-left: auto; }
body { color: black; font-family: Arial; background-color: #46454a; background-image: url(images/sdesign/blackback.jpg); background-repeat:no-repeat; text-align: center; margin: 0; padding: 0; }
#navcontainer
{ background-color: #14090d; margin-left: auto; margin-right: auto; margin-bottom: 20px; border-top: 1px solid #999; z-index: 1; }
#navcontainer ul
{
list-style-type: none;
text-align: center;
margin-top: -5px;
padding: 0;
position: relative;
z-index: 2;
}
#navcontainer li
{
display: inline;
text-align: center;
margin: 0 5px;
}
#navcontainer li a
{ padding: 1px 7px; color: #4d4d4d; font-size: 16px; background-color: #e8cf3e; border: solid 1px #c00437; text-decoration: none; }
#navcontainer li a:hover
{ color: #e1d44a; background-color: #e2043f; border-color: #666; border-style: solid; border-width: 2px 1px; }
#navcontainer li a#current
{
color: #000;
border: 1px solid #666;
border-top: 2px solid #666;
border-bottom: 2px solid #666;
}
#topcontent { color: #fff; font-size: 14px; background-color: black; text-align: center; position: relative; height: 188px; min-width: 1000px; padding-top: 10px; padding-bottom: 10px; }
.inhalt { font-family: Arial, "Arial Narrow"; text-align: left; width: 830px; margin-right: auto; margin-left: auto; }
h1 { color: #fff; font-size: 2em; font-weight: bold; text-align: center; margin: 25px 0; }
.left { float: left; margin-right: 10px; border: groove 1px #b4b2bd; }
.box { background-color: #dbc850; width: 354px; float: left; border: ridge 2px #b4b2bd; }
h3 { color: #34101a; font-size: 16px; font-weight: bold; background-color: #fff113; text-align: center; margin: 1em 0; }
.box2 { background-color: #e2043f; width: 300px; float: right; }
h2 { color: #e1d44a; font-size: 16px; font-weight: bold; background-color: #000; text-align: center; margin: 0.83em 0; }
